Can you eat yogurt before colonoscopy? This is a common question among individuals scheduled for a colonoscopy, a procedure used to examine the colon for abnormalities. The answer to this question is both straightforward and nuanced, as it depends on the dietary guidelines provided by the healthcare provider and the specific preparation required for the procedure.
Colonoscopies are typically performed to detect and diagnose conditions such as colon cancer, inflammatory bowel disease, and polyps. In order to ensure the procedure is as effective as possible, the colon must be thoroughly cleaned of all waste material. This is achieved through a process known as bowel preparation, which often involves fasting, drinking a large volume of clear fluids, and taking laxatives.
When it comes to yogurt and other dairy products, the general rule is to avoid them before a colonoscopy. This is because dairy can contain lactose, a sugar that can ferment in the colon and lead to gas and bloating. These symptoms can make it difficult for the healthcare provider to get a clear view of the colon during the procedure. However, the specifics can vary based on individual circumstances.

During the bowel preparation phase, it is essential to adhere to the dietary restrictions outlined by your healthcare provider. This often means consuming a clear liquid diet, which may include water, broth, and clear juices. In some instances, your provider may recommend a specific diet plan leading up to the procedure, which could include avoiding certain types of yogurt or dairy products altogether.
